upcarta
Sign In
Sign Up
Explore
Search
Alistair MacDonald
Follow
No followers
community-curated profile
Senior reporter at The Wall Street Journal. Views expressed are my own.
Featured content
See All
Christmas Chaos: Shipping Delays Mean Santa Might Be Late This Year
by Alistair MacDonald